£50 million fund will invest alongside Business Angels

Image

A new Angel co-investment fund will be operational in the next few months, making £50m available to invest alongside Business Angel syndicates into eligible SMEs.

The fund will invest alongside and on the same terms as the syndicates and will provide funding to individual businesses of between £50k and £1m in investment rounds ranging from £200k upwards.

The investment needs to be a new investment for the syndicate and should be of a size sufficient enough to properly fund the business and to allow for the cost of proper due diligence and legal advice.

The fund will be administered on a day to day basis by CfEL, the UK Government’s centre of knowledge, expertise and information on the design, implementation and management of finance measures to support Small and Medium Size enterprises (‘SMEs’) across the UK.
